I don't know if you can plan in advance or not. From my experience I never find a significant difference in prices between the alliances. That is if you're flexible on the routing. Eg. Direct flights with OW can be more expensive than indirect flights on other alliances.
I usually start planning 4 to 6 months out (I know this is not possible for business travel but as your question is regarding pricing I think it's regarding leisure trips). I compare rates to find a reasonable price and then I start monitoring OW rates to reach this price level.
Over the last years I never had to pay more for a OW flight.
I'm based in EU and my experience is mainly with AA, BA, AB and AY.
